2006 Ford Expedition vs. 1955 Jensen Interceptor

To start off, 2006 Ford Expedition is newer by 51 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1955 Jensen Interceptor.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1955 Jensen Interceptor would be higher. At 5,408 cc (8 cylinders), 2006 Ford Expedition is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Ford Expedition (301 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 172 more horse power than 1955 Jensen Interceptor. (129 HP @ 3700 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2006 Ford Expedition should accelerate faster than 1955 Jensen Interceptor.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Ford Expedition weights approximately 220 kg more than 1955 Jensen Interceptor.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 2006 Ford Expedition (495 Nm @ 3750 RPM) has 208 more torque (in Nm) than 1955 Jensen Interceptor. (287 Nm @ 2200 RPM). This means 2006 Ford Expedition will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1955 Jensen Interceptor.
